Curry scores 300th triple of the season and reaches milestone for fifth season

SAN FRANCISCO (AP) — Stephen Curry reached 300 3-pointers for the fifth season, an NBA record, and finished with 14 points and four 3-pointers to be one of seven Golden State players to score at least 10 points in the victory of the Warriors 137-116 on Wednesday against the Memphis Grizzlies.

Jonathan Kuminga had 26 points, Andrew Wiggins added 22 points and 10 rebounds, and Klay Thompson scored 23 off the bench. Chris Paul had a season-high 14 assists in the team’s 30th game with at least 30 assists. The team finished with a season-high 43.

GG Jackson II scored 35 points and Jaren Jackson Jr. contributed 28 for Memphis, which lost in overtime 121-111 to Sacramento on Monday and has lost four in a row and six in seven games. Santi Aldama had 15 of his 27 goals in the second period and arrived with 21 at halftime.

With his second three-pointer with 2:30 left, Memphis closed within 58-56. A pair of Jackson Jr. free throws tied the game with 2:07 left in the half, but Golden State responded with 10 straight points to go into halftime ahead 68-58.
